Novel X-Ray Backlighting Method for Rayleigh-Taylor Instability Measurements on Ablatively Driven Targets

摘要

This document describes a face-on-x-ray backlighting method that does not require a dedicated laser beam and a separate x-ray source. This method is used to measure the lateral mass transfer characteristic of the Rayleigh-Taylor instability in ablatively accelerated, laser driven targets. (Author)
